Control Systems (ELE320)
The content is related to automation and control of industrial process, including matematical modeling and simulation, state space analysis, transfer functions, frequency response analysis, and tuning of standard controllers (P, PI, PID).

Learning outcome
- To understand the concept of mathematical modelling and simulation of systems described by differential equations.
- Knowledge of the use of MATLAB to simulate systems
- To understand the concept of negative feedback
- To present mathematical models as block diagrams
- To find transfer functions and to perform the frequency response analysis
- To investigate stability issues and tune standard regulators (P, PI, PID).
- To have a basic understanding of systems analysis and control design techniques.
- To organize models as state space models and to perform linearization of nonlinear systems.

Vilkår for å gå opp til eksamen/vurdering
8 theoretical assignments of which 4 must be approved. 6 compulsory lab assignments.
Mandatory work demands (such as hand in assignments, lab- assignments, projects, etc) must be approved by the course teacher within the specified deadlines.
